The digital platform Capitol CNCT is helping young congressional staffers identify “bad bosses” and toxic offices without fear of backlash. “Built by a former staffer, for the staffers who came after him,” the website, which was founded by former staffer David Tennent, reads. He said he became frustrated when he worked on Capitol Hill, explaining that it was very difficult to find information about which offices to work for. “My biggest fear was just creating like a political retribution platform, right?” Top rated Senate offices to work in include Sen. Eric Schmitt’s (R-MO), Sen. Tommy Tuberville’s (R-AL), Sen. Kevin Cramer’s (R-ND), Sen. Thom Tillis’s (R-NC), and Sen. Todd Young’s (R-IN).
